How they compare
Singapore currently reports 3.78 % change on previous year against 3.75 % change on previous year in Guinea, a difference of 0.03 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 40 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Singapore ahead.
Guinea ranks 106th and Singapore ranks 104th of 192 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Guinea averaged higher in 6 and Singapore in 1.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Cooling Degree Days.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
